Step by step
- Schedule a studio session.
- From the scheduling page, to the right of Audience registration, toggle on
to enable it.
When the toggle is on, you are restricted from inviting audience members via email. - Under Registration type, select Direct session link.
- Add a Title and Description.
- Click Preview registration page to review the layout and ensure everything looks correct.
- Click Create session.
The session is shown at the top of the project page. - Click Copy join link.
Good to know
- Attendees can only enter their email address once using the link. If an attendee accidentally enters their details before the time of the event, ask them to join at the correct time using a different email address.
-
You cannot use both the direct session link and the registration form simultaneously for the same scheduled event.
-
With the join link, attendees enter their name and email when the session starts and then join as audience members.
- Registrants can join from the Riverside iOS app or via the web using Chrome or Edge.
- Audience registration applies only to studio sessions hosted on Riverside and does not extend to streams hosted on other channels.
-
Email notifications are not supported when using a direct session link, as audience details are only collected after they join the session.
Next steps
- If you want to add an audience member at the last minute, you can copy and share the join link from the scheduled event panel in the studio.
- The event will remain visible in the project folder for one month for your reference. After that, you can always download the registration details from the Recording Files.
- After the session, you can see who attended and cross-reference this with those who pre-registered outside of Riverside. Please note that this information is not available for people who did not register, such as invited guests.
- Your customized settings are saved for the next event hosted in the same studio.
